LVN Clinic Supervisor-Primary Care

POSITION SUMMARY/RESPONSIBILITIES

Supervises clinic staff along with daily operations to ensure compliance with policies and procedures and enforce standard of work

Participates in lean processes and in the development of policies and programs intended to improve the delivery of care and maintain accreditation

Develops schedules for clinic staff to ensure adequate coverage

Conducts staff meetings to provide education, updates, and general information as needed

Monitors and influences key performance metrics as assigned

Provide direct patient care as needed

Demonstrates competence to perform assigned patient care responsibilities in a manner that meets the age-specific and developmental needs of patients served by primary care to include adults and children.

 

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E

Graduation from an accredited School of Vocational Nursing is required.  Recommend at least two years experience in an outpatient setting with progressive responsibilities.  Recommend at least two years experience in a supervisory/management position in a health care setting. 

 

LICENSURE

            Must possess a current license to practice Vocational Nursing in the State of Texas. Must maintain a current CPR Certification. ACLS certification is preferred.
